Minutes — Management Meeting, Q3 Cash-Flow Forecast
Attendees: R. Calvert, M. Osei, T. Brandle.
Forecast reviewed. Receivables from the Norvale account slipping 30 days; adjust inflow assumptions. Capex on the Drell line deferred to Q4. Payroll steady. Net position tightens in week 9; bridge facility pre-approved if gap exceeds threshold. Osei to reissue model by Friday. Brandle to confirm supplier terms with Quenby Fabrication. Next review in two weeks. One item follows for restricted circulation.

board note of tadup-tajog: Headcount on the Oliiel team goes from 31 to 88 by the end of February. Gross margin on Oliiel came in at 62 percent against a plan of 29 percent.

## Environments — RemindlyCare Appointment Nudger

The reminder job runs nightly for all clinics on the Havenbrook platform. There are three environments: dev, staging, and prod. Dev uses synthetic patient rosters only; staging mirrors prod schedules but routes SMS to a sink. As a contractor you'll mostly touch staging. The job reads its settings at startup, so any change requires a redeploy via the Lanternby pipeline. The current staging configuration values are listed below for reference.

deployment values, kajep-kageg:
[praix]
host = praix.paliqcorp.corp
user = praix_svc
database = praix_prod

Plugin authors targeting the Ledgerpine payroll exporter should know the format changed in release 12: the fixed-width layout is gone, replaced by delimited records with a versioned header row. Old parsers will silently misread pay-period boundaries, so bump your adapters before the next cycle. Dorin finished the exporter side; Maelle owns plugin compatibility from here. The sandbox is already running the new format. To reproduce our test environment, the exporter runs with the following configuration.

service settings:
PRAIX_LOG_LEVEL=error
PRAIX_METRICS_HOST=metrics.praix.qorvelcorp.corp
PRAIX_POOL_SIZE=16